| COMMUNITY PROFILE |
| British Columbia > Port Coquitlam |
2001 population: 51,257 (Source: Statistics Canada) Port Coquitlam is a city in the province of British Columbia. It is on the Fraser, Pitt and Coquitlam rivers. The community was named for the Coquitlam tribe.
Filming location for 2007 movie, "Fantastic Four: Rise of the Silver Surfer"
Well-known residents have included:
· Terry Fox, who ran a "Marathon of Hope" across Canada despite having lost a leg to cancer
Nearby parks & recreation: Colony Farm Regional Park
Transit: TransLink, West Coast Express
